How is this appetizer prepared?

The main rule in the preparation of these rolls is not to fill the pita bread too much. The more fillings you put, the more chances you have of getting air pockets and ruining the design of the snack.

How to make stuffed pita rolls? Make sure the cakes are at room temperature before you start wrapping them. They must be soft and flexible. Smaller tortillas can be used, however you will need to adjust the amount of filling you add.

How to make pita bread with the filling? If you have little free time, you can skip cooling before slicing or leave the product in the refrigerator for a while. However, pre-cooling is recommended for best results.

Roll lavash as tight as possible. Cut off the ends of an already twisted article. Cut into even slices, their width should be about 3-4 centimeters.

What to make pita bread with? The filling may be different. Make sure you choose something soft but solid as the foundation. Spread a generous layer of cream cheese, hummus, guacamole, or something similar, over the pita, then spread the cut solid foods. It can be vegetables, fruits, meat, cheeses, nuts and so on.

Cheese and Broccoli Option

What can I make pita bread with? The ideal filling is soft cream cheese, which goes well with most foods, including vegetables. You will need the following:

  • 240 grams of soft cream cheese;
  • a glass of sour cream;
  • Ranch sauce bag
  • a glass of grated cheddar cheese;
  • a glass of chopped broccoli;
  • a glass of finely chopped cauliflower and carrots.

The most useful vegetable filling is prepared like this. Combine cream cheese, sour cream and Ranch sauce and beat with a mixer. Put in a separate container slightly boiled broccoli, cauliflower and carrots, mix with grated cheese. Spread the cream cheese mixture evenly over the pita bread. Put the vegetables with cheese and spin the roll. Place it with the seam down and refrigerate for thirty minutes. Cut into slices before serving.

Option with turkey (club sandwich in pita bread)

This is one of the most delicious toppings for pita bread. For this snack, you can use colored pita bread (with a taste of greens), but the usual one is also great. For one roll you will need the following:

  • mayonnaise;
  • mustard;
  • 60 grams of turkey ham;
  • 2 slices of bacon;
  • 60 grams avocado chopped thinly;
  • 2 slices of tomato;
  • a glass of crushed iceberg lettuce.

Spread thin slices of turkey ham over the pita bread, then fold the remaining ingredients on top in the order in which they are listed above. Roll the roll, cool and chop. You can store this appetizer in an airtight container for 3 days if you make it in advance.

Bacon variant

Another option for what can be done with pita bread. The filling recipe is extremely simple. This simple appetizer only takes ten minutes to cook. For her, you will need the following:

  • 240 grams of softened cream cheese;
  • a glass of cheddar cheese;
  • 6 slices of bacon, fried and chopped;
  • 3 tablespoons Ranch sauce;
  • 2 tablespoons chopped green onions.

In a large bowl, mix all the ingredients except the green onions. Put the pita bread on a plate and spread on it an even layer of a mixture of bacon and cheese (2 to 3 tablespoons). Roll the cake tightly and place on a separate plate. Repeat with all remaining ingredients. Put in the refrigerator for 2 hours. Then cut into slices and garnish with finely chopped green onions.

Crab stick option

This is an interesting appetizer of pita bread stuffed with crab sticks, cheese, garlic and herbs. Such rolls are perfect as a snack or snack, go well with beer. To prepare them, you will need the following:

  • packaging of crab sticks for 240 grams (surimi);
  • 100 grams of grated cheese;
  • a bunch of green parsley;
  • a bunch of green dill;
  • 1 small garlic clove;
  • mayonnaise.

This pita filling with crab sticks is very easy to prepare. Cut the crab sticks, move them into a bowl. Add all the cheese to them. Finely chop the dill and parsley, and then put them in a bowl to the rest of the ingredients.

Peel and chop the garlic. Mix it with other ingredients and mayonnaise. You must determine its quantity yourself: the filling for pita bread should not be liquid. It should be homogeneous and similar to a standard spread.

Put one pita bread on the plate (do not heat it, otherwise it will not work out), apply an even layer of filling on it. Roll into a roll and wrap with cling film. Put in the refrigerator for at least thirty minutes.

Immediately before serving, remove the pita bread from the refrigerator, remove the wrapper and cut into pieces.

Option with cranberries and feta cheese

How to make delicious lavash stuffed? To do this, put something unusual in it, for example, dried cranberries. This appetizer turns out to be very bright, while it has an interesting taste. In total you will need:

  • a glass of feta cheese;
  • 240 grams of whipped cream cheese;
  • 150 grams of dried sweetened cranberries;
  • a quarter cup of chopped green onions.

In a large bowl, mix all the ingredients. A homogeneous mass should be obtained. Put the pita bread on the table and evenly distribute a layer of cranberry-cheese mixture (about 2-3 tablespoons). Roll it tightly into a roll and put on a plate. Refrigerate for two hours. Cut each rolled cake from the ends and place on a plate.

Green garlic and turkey option

This is one of the most delicious filling pita recipes and the perfect snack for warm summer days. It is healthy, easy to make from any of your favorite ingredients. For such a roll you will need:

  • 3 l.st. cream cheese mixed with chopped green garlic;
  • 2 slices of turkey fillet;
  • 1/3 cup thinly sliced ​​cucumbers.

Apply a thin layer of cheese mixed with chopped young garlic to the pita bread. Spread turkey fillet over slices, then sprinkle with cucumber slices. Roll tightly and leave in the refrigerator for 2-3 hours. Before serving, cut into slices.

Hummus and spinach option

Such pita bread can be safely attributed to a healthy diet, especially if you take the whole-grain version. For cooking, you will need ingredients such as:

  • a quarter cup of hummus;
  • half a glass of chopped spinach leaves;
  • a third of a glass of thinly chopped red pepper.

How to make pita roll with hummus filling? Lay the pita bread on the work surface. Lubricate it with an even layer of hummus, then spread the spinach leaves and slices of pepper. Roll the roll as tight as possible. Leave to cool for several hours, then chop.

Chicken and Guacamole Sauce

What to make pita bread with? The filling may also contain such a component as guacamole sauce. This version of rolls is very tender. As a filling, the following applies:

  • a quarter cup of guacamole;
  • half a glass of smoked chicken breast, cut into pieces;
  • half a glass of finely grated sharp cheese.

Spread the guacamole evenly over the surface of the pita bread. Spread the remaining components of the filling on top. Tightly roll the roll and cut into slices 3-4 cm thick.

Spicy Chicken Option

How to make a delicious pita bread stuffed at home? A good option would be to use spicy chicken breasts. In this case, you have to cook the ingredients for the filling yourself. In total you will need:

  • 1.5 kg of boneless and skinless chicken breasts;
  • 1 small jar of canned tomatoes, diced;
  • 360 grams of softened cream cheese;
  • a glass of grated cheddar or Monterey Jack cheese;
  • 1 garlic clove minced;
  • 3 tsp anchovy chilli powder;
  • 1 teaspoon caraway seeds;
  • 1/2 h.p. cayenne pepper;
  • 1/2 teaspoon of salt;
  • a quarter cup of crushed cilantro;
  • 6 stalks of leeks (sliced ​​white and green parts).

Season the chicken breasts with salt, half a teaspoon of caraway seeds and 1 tsp. chili powder. Put them in a large pot and add about 1 cup of water. Cover and simmer until cooked for about 8 minutes. Add more water if necessary.

Once the chicken is cooked, place it on a plate or cutting board, cool slightly and chop.

In a separate bowl, combine cream cheese, tomatoes, Cheddar cheese, remaining spices, garlic, cilantro and green onions. Add chilled chicken and mix.

Lay the cakes on a table and evenly distribute the mixture in the center of each of them. Spread the filling with a thin layer, leaving free edges one and a half centimeters. Wrap each pita roll tightly. Use a sharp knife to cut it into slices 3 cm thick, transfer to a dish. Cover with cling film and refrigerate.

Chicken and Parmesan Option

Chicken and Parmesan rolls are a good savory snack. This is one of the most delicious toppings for pita bread. To prepare them, you will need:

  • 1 chicken breast without bones and skin;
  • 480 grams of softened cream cheese;
  • one and a half glasses of mozzarella grated cheese;
  • a quarter cup of Parmesan cheese;
  • a glass of tomato pasta sauce;
  • half hp dried basil;
  • half hp dried parsley;
  • a quarter of an hour onion powder;
  • a quarter of an hour salts;
  • 1/8 h pepper;
  • chopped fresh parsley (for decoration).

Heat a large frying pan over medium heat. Cut the chicken breast in half lengthwise to get 2 thin large pieces. Season both sides with salt and pepper. Cook for 3 to 4 minutes on each side until it is no longer pink. Remove from heat and transfer to chopping board. Cool.

Once the chicken has cooled, cut it into cubes. You should get about 2 glasses of the finished product.

In a medium bowl, use a large spoon or a rubber spatula, mix cream cheese, mozzarella and parmesan until smooth. Add to this mixture chicken, pasta sauce, dried basil and parsley, onion powder, salt and pepper. Mix until smooth.

Place the tortilla on a flat surface. Spread the mixture in an even thick layer on it. Gently roll the roll. Cool the product for 20 minutes so that everything is saturated - this makes it easy to cut.

Use a sharp knife, cut the cake into 8 equal parts. Place the rolls with the cut side up on the plate. Sprinkle some fresh parsley for decoration. Serve immediately or cover with cling film and store in the refrigerator until ready to eat.

Hawaiian version

Many love Hawaiian pizza due to the unusual combination of ham and pineapple. But such an application of these products can take place in other snacks, including rolls. To prepare it you will need:

  • 240 grams of soft cream cheese;
  • a can of canned pineapple (without liquid);
  • 2 bunches of green onions;
  • 12-16 slices of thinly sliced ​​ham.

How to make Hawaiian pita filling? The recipe is pretty simple. Combine softened cream cheese, small pieces of pineapple and green onions in a medium bowl. Spread this mixture in a thin layer over pita bread. Put a layer of ham on top (about 3-4 slices for each pita bread). Gently but tightly roll the pita bread, then use a serrated knife to cut the roll into 6 slices (cut the ends so that it looks beautiful!). Serve immediately or refrigerate until ready to eat.

Salami option

Typically, ham or chicken is used in such rolls. But smoked sausage will also be a great filling. To prepare this appetizer, you will need:

  • 500 grams of salami (cut into thin slices);
  • 2 garlic cloves finely chopped;
  • 240 grams of cream cheese, stored at room temperature;
  • 4 tablespoons thinly chopped green onions (only green parts);
  • 2 tablespoons Dijon mustard;
  • 1/4 h salts;

Heat a large frying pan over medium heat. Fry the sausage until brown for about 8 minutes. Put it in a bowl with a paper towel at the bottom while you prepare the rest of the ingredients.

In a separate container, place cream cheese, garlic, green onions, mustard, salt and pepper. Use a wooden spoon or a strong rubber spatula to mix everything until smooth. Distribute this mass on the surface of the pita, leaving one free centimeter at the edges. Spread the slices of toasted sausage on top.

Gently roll the pita bread until you get a tight roll. Seam down. Use a sharp knife to cut off both ends of the roll, in which there is no filling. Cut the rest into even slices and put on a dish.

Option with sun-dried tomatoes and basil

Fragrant dried tomatoes and basil go well with thin pita bread. This is the perfect summer snack. To prepare it you will need:

  • soft cream cheese - 240 grams;
  • half a glass of slightly condensed sun-dried tomatoes (dry, not in oil);
  • a quarter cup of slightly condensed spinach;
  • 2 large cloves of minced garlic;
  • a quarter cup of parmesan cheese;
  • 1 pinch of sea salt and black pepper;
  • 24 fresh basil leaves.

Add cream cheese, sun-dried tomatoes, spinach, garlic, Parmesan cheese, salt and pepper into a bowl and mix thoroughly to get a smooth mass. Spread the prepared filling on the pita evenly. Lay the basil leaves on top and squeeze them so that they stick slightly. Roll pita roll tightly and place rolls seam down. Cut into slices. Arrange on a dish and serve immediately or refrigerate for up to 24 hours, covered with cling film. Leftovers are perfectly stored in the refrigerator for up to 2-3 days.

Classic smoked ham and cheese

This classic pita filling is popular along with crab sticks. This appetizer is suitable for both a party and a quick breakfast (if you cook it in the evening). For her you will need:

  • 240 grams of cream cheese;
  • coarse sea salt;
  • a large package of thinly sliced ​​smoked ham;
  • a large can of pickled cucumbers.

Lubricate the pita bread with a thick layer of cream cheese and sprinkle with sea salt. Lay thin slices of ham and finely chopped pickled cucumbers on top. Roll the roll. Slice into even slices.

Hot spinach with sour cream and mayonnaise

Most often, pita rolls are served cold. However, this appetizer may be hot. To prepare it, you will need the following:

  • a glass of frozen chopped spinach (thawed and dried);
  • 120 grams of softened cream cheese;
  • half a glass of sour cream;
  • a quarter cup of mayonnaise;
  • 1 small onion, diced into small cubes;
  • half a glass of grated Parmesan cheese;
  • half a glass of grated Mozzarella cheese;
  • sea ​​salt and pepper.

Combine spinach, cream cheese, sour cream and mayonnaise until smooth. Add onions and cheese and mix. Put spinach on pita bread, spread the resulting mass on top. Roll into a roll and cut into slices 3 cm wide. Put them on a greased baking sheet and bake for 25-30 minutes.
